Title |
DNA sequencing of Medicago truncatula from ChIP-seq experiment - roots of germinated seeds at 1mm, 1mm+PEG, 5mm (after immunoprecipitation of H2AK119Ub) |
Organism |
Medicago truncatula |
Experiment type |
Genome binding/occupancy profiling by high throughput sequencing
|
Summary |
We performed Chromatine ImmunoPrecipitation of the Histone H2AK119Ub mark in 1- and 5mm Medicago (A17) radicles which were desiccation sensitive (R1 and R5) and desiccation tolerant (R1P). Roots at 1mm were dried for 72hs and are desiccation sensitive, roots at 1mm plus incubation in PEG 8000 at -1.7Mpa for 72h at 10°C then dried for 72hs are desiccation tolerant and roots at 5mm dried for 72h are desication sensitive
|
|
|
Overall design |
Two replicates of at least 700 radicles at each stages
